Enjoy fresh air and friendly company with weekly walks at Rayment Reserve, perfect for parents, caregivers, and children.


Looking for a refreshing way to get outdoors and connect with other parents and caregivers? The Pram Walking Group offers a wonderful opportunity to enjoy beautiful landscapes while engaging in gentle physical activity. This free weekly event welcomes families of all ages to join in a supportive and social environment.

What to Expect

Each session begins with a pleasant walk starting at 9:30am, followed by a relaxing coffee and playtime at the nearby playground. The group is designed to be inclusive and welcoming, providing a chance to meet like-minded people while your little ones have fun.

Activity Details

- Weekly walks every Wednesday from 11th February to 24th June 2026

- Duration approximately 55 minutes, from 9:30am to 10:25am

- Suitable for parents, caregivers, and children of all ages

- No booking required; simply arrive at the meeting point

Location and Access

Meet at the gazebo in Rayment Reserve, located at 1 Rayment Street, Lathlain, on Whadjuk Noongar Boodja. The reserve offers easy access and a safe, family-friendly environment for walking and play.

Important Information

This is a free community event encouraging physical activity and social connection. Participants are encouraged to wear comfortable walking shoes and bring water. The playground provides a great spot for children to enjoy after the walk.

Booking and Prices

No booking is necessary for this event. Participation is completely free, making it an accessible and enjoyable option for families looking to stay active and connected in the local community.
